我已经在ca- created区域创建了一个AWS ECS实例。它使用动态公网ip,每次我更新服务时,动态公网ip都会发生变化。到目前为止一切都很好。
由于需要公网静态IP,我已经创建了同地域的弹性ip,并尝试将该ip与ECS实例关联。
Resource Type: Network Interface
Reassociation: Allow this Elastic IP address to be reassociated (checked)
当我尝试这样做时,它抛出这样的错误:弹性IP地址无法关联。弹性IP地址nn.nn:您没有访问指定资源的权限。
我需要为我的两个站点分配一个单独的ip地址,因此我手动配置Amazon Web服务,使一个实例拥有两个公共ip。我设置了两个弹性up,它们指向两个私有up,它们都在一个网络接口下。
需要对OS (Debian 7)进行哪些手动更改才能使辅助弹性(公有) ip正常工作?
这就是/etc/network/interface现在的样子:
auto lo
iface lo inet loopback
auto eth0
iface eth0 inet dhcp
附注:似乎没有针对debian的ec2-net-utils包,所以我手动进行了操作,从而也了解了网络是如何工作的。
我在亚马逊有两台机器。web01和db01。我在db01上安装了PostgreSQL,并在pg_hba.conf中添加了web01的弹性ip
host dbname username 64.210.245.155/32 md5
并重新启动了postgresql服务。现在在web01中,我尝试连接到db01的弹性ip
$ psql -h 64.210.255.222 -U user -d database
psql: could not connect to server: No route to host
Is the server running on host "64.21